How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Upper Arlington?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Upper Arlington Studio Apartments | $1,187 | $700 | $2,363 |
Upper Arlington 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,580 | $845 | $5,704 |
Upper Arlington 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,042 | $860 | $6,668 |
Upper Arlington 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,423 | $800 | $5,910 |
Upper Arlington 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,513 | $585 | $3,400 |
